Summary: | PROBLEM TO BE SOLVED: To improve power generation performance of a fuel cell by improving a catalyst ink for forming a catalyst electrode layer.SOLUTION: A method for manufacturing a catalyst ink for forming a catalyst electrode layer including a polymer electrolyte having proton conductivity and a catalyst particle having a catalyst comprises steps of: preparing a polymer electrolyte precursor which turns into a polymer electrolyte having proton conductivity via hydrolysis treatment, a high oxygen permeable resin which is a fluorine resin having higher oxygen permeability than the polymer electrolyte, and a fluorine-based solvent which can dissolve the high oxygen permeable resin; and mixing the polymer electrolyte precursor, the high oxygen permeable resin, and the fluorine-based solvent and dispersing the polymer electrolyte precursor into a resin solution in which the high oxygen permeable resin is dissolved in the fluorine-based solvent. |
